What are they?
The purpose of bad credit consolidation loans is to combine all the debt you owe into one larger debt so that you only have to make one payment instead of several.

If you currently have debt on several high-interest credit cards, considering bad credit consolidation loans will allow you to take out a lower-interest loan for the total amount you owe and use the money to pay off the balance on each credit card. Instead of making five payments each month at different interest rates, you pay one low-interest payment to one lender.
Bad credit consolidation loans are almost always secured loans since the lower your credit score is, the more risk a lender has to take when they lend you money. Lenders compensate for this risk by charging a higher interest rate unless there is some form of high-quality collateral to guarantee the repayment of the loan.
Of course, the interest on these loans will vary widely from lender to lender, so it’s in your best interest to shop around and get quotes from different lenders before making a loan decision.
How Bad Credit Loans Help You
Bad credit consolidation loans can provide additional benefits beyond simply reducing the monthly payments you have to make. Depending on the terms of the loan, it can also reduce your overall debt.
The lender may choose to offer you a loan with a lower interest rate to replace the variable rates on credit cards and other debt, meaning you can significantly reduce the interest charges you pay on the money you borrow. In addition, you have simplified your life – everything must be paid on one date and in one payment.
Your credit score can also rise due to the loan you take out.
Instead of your older debts continuing to hurt your credit, all you need to do is regularly report the consolidation loan to the credit bureaus. While this won’t immediately remove the damage already done, over time your older negative reports will begin to decay and the positive reports made while paying the loan on time will significantly increase your creditworthiness.
